PENINSULA ROLL OF HONOUR.

TROOP BR ALEC ADAMS.

Trooper Alec Adams of Akaroa, who left with the Main Expeditionary forces in the C.V 0. bas quite recover ed from tho effects of the wound in big leg, and when last be wrote was baok at Ansae. Trooper Adams was shot above the knee and tbe leg was not enly numb, but appeared to be shrinking. Ue was taken to Malta and it was thought he would have to go to England for an operation. Fortunately the application of a battery in tbe Malta hospital was quite enough to make a permanent cure. While on his way baok to the front Trooper Adams spent some weeks in Egypt and was delighted to run across the Peninsula boys in the sixth and hear the latest Akaroa news.
